If you’re ready to take on the challenge of changing your battery yourself, follow the steps below.

The item you will need to replace your iPhone battery includes a specially made screwdriver called a Torx screwdriver kit. Also, you will need a spare battery. Both are available at numerous online retailers. Now let’s start with the repair process.

The first step in removing an iPhone battery is to insert the pointed end of a safety pin into the small hole next to the headphone jack. This will eject the tray portion of the back plate. Next, remove the two screws on either side of the end of the base. Now you want to separate the front screen from the back panel by fitting the spudger between the glass front panel and the chrome ring. Always be careful not to tear the tapes that still connect both panels together. Then remove the wires labeled “1” and then “2” in that particular order with the spudger. The last ribbon cable can be released by lifting the white tab that holds it in place. This will allow the front and rear shells to separate completely. Next, remove the eight screws holding the motherboard. Undo the tape labeled “4,” then lift off the motherboard. A tape going to the camera will still bind it. Remove that particular tape from the camera to set the motherboard aside. Pry up the camera to allow the logic board to slide out. Be sure to remove all screws holding the logic board in before doing so. Pull the tab on the battery to remove it. Replace it with a new one, and then put all the pieces back together in the reverse order you removed them.
